Vegetable Stir-Fry Recipe

Description

Sizzling Vegetable Stir-Fry brings crisp garden produce together in a quick, aromatic dance of flavor. Colorful peppers, tender carrots, and zesty ginger create a delightful Asian-inspired meal you’ll crave after just one bite.


Ingredients

Scale

Main Ingredients:

  • 1/2 cup vegetable broth (or chicken broth)
  • 1/3 cup low-sodium soy sauce
  • 1 1/2 tablespoons fresh ginger, minced
  • 3 cloves garlic, minced

Sweeteners and Oils:

  • 2 tablespoons honey
  • 2 teaspoons sesame oil

Thickeners and Spices:

  • 1 tablespoon cornstarch
  • 1/8 teaspoon crushed red pepper flakes (optional)

Instructions

  1. Craft a zesty sauce by blending vegetable broth, soy sauce, honey, sesame oil, minced ginger, crushed garlic, cornstarch, and red pepper flakes in a small mixing bowl. Let the mixture rest momentarily.
  2. Warm a large skillet or wok with oil over medium-high temperature. Introduce broccoli and carrots, tossing vigorously to ensure even cooking for approximately two minutes.
  3. Drizzle additional oil into the pan and incorporate mushrooms and snap peas. Continue aggressive stirring, maintaining high heat for another two minutes until vegetables develop slight caramelization.
  4. Integrate red and yellow bell peppers into the vegetable medley. Rapidly stir-fry for one minute, ensuring vegetables maintain a crisp, vibrant texture.
  5. Re-whisk the prepared sauce to guarantee thorough integration. Cascade sauce over sizzling vegetables, stirring persistently until the liquid transforms into a glossy, thickened coating (roughly 1-2 minutes).
  6. Sprinkle freshly chopped green onions into the glistening mixture, allowing their sharp flavor to permeate the dish.
  7. Transfer the aromatic stir-fry onto a bed of steamed rice or quinoa. Optional: Garnish with extra green onion slivers and a delicate sprinkle of sesame seeds for enhanced visual and textural appeal.

Notes

  • Customize heat levels by adjusting red pepper flakes for mild or spicy preferences.
  • Slice vegetables uniformly to ensure even cooking and consistent texture throughout the dish.
  • Use high-heat cooking oil like avocado or grapeseed for better caramelization and crisp vegetable edges.
  • Substitute honey with maple syrup or agave for vegan-friendly option and maintain similar sweetness profile.
